Before Howarth made his debut in the October 31, 2025, episode of Y&R, Stafford was already expressing her excitement at the Daytime Emmy winner joining the cast alongside fellow Genoa City newcomer Tamara Braun (Sienna). “Not only because these two are extraordinary actors, but because they are my friends!” she enthused in another Instagram post.
Stafford previously worked with Howarth on General Hospital. He was playing Franco Baldwin when she joined the ABC soap in 2014 for a five-year run as Nina Reeves. Their characters were involved in a rather unconventional love story that kicked off when the characters were fugitives. In the storyline, Franco ran away to Canada with Nina to raise the baby she’d stolen from Ava (Maura West) at birth. After being apprehended, the characters were committed to a mental institution, where their bond deepened and they shared their first kiss.

Mad Love: Howarth’s Franco and Stafford’s Nina became an unlikely pair on GH.
“I’ll be honest — that storyline is definitely in the top two storylines that I’ve done in daytime,” Stafford told Soap Opera Digest in 2023 of the unorthodox Franco/Nina pairing. “I know it was riddled with traps. I know that we were away from the rest of the canvas. I know that, but to me a love story told in a psych ward was really cool and interesting.” She also praised Howarth as a “very inventive and complex” actor.
Ironically, during a rough patch in Franco and Nina’s relationship in 2015, she impulsively ran off and married scheming Ric Lansing, played by Rick Hearst. Hearst was the last actor to play Matt Clark, with his own Y&R stint lasting from 2000-01.
